"text": "<title level=\"1\" right=\"Feat 20\" pfs=\"\" > Stalking Feline Mask May contain spoilers from Strength of Thousands Source Pathfinder #174: Shadows of the Ancients pg. 78 Archetypes Druid, Wizard (Level 20) Prerequisites Druid Dedication or Wizard Dedication --- Like Azure Leopard, the Patient Warden, your mask makes you most at home in the night and teaches you how to use the darkness to hunt. You gain greater darkvision. Immediately after you Cast a non-cantrip Spell with the shadow or darkness trait, you can attempt to Hide or Sneak as a free action. You must still meet the usual requirements of the action you choose, such as having cover or concealment to Hide and being undetected or hidden to Sneak. Masks of the Magic Warriors Source Pathfinder #174: Shadows of the Ancients pg. 78 In becoming Jatembe's new Magic Warriors, the heroes have unlocked secrets of magical potential that none have reached since the earliest Ten Magic Warriors walked the plazas of the Magaambya. On reaching 20th level, the heroes should have the option of taking one of these archetype feats, based on the type of animal they chose for their mask when they first created it in Pathfinder Adventure Path #169: Kindled Magic . These options are each themed to one of Jatembe's magic warriors, but if a hero's mask doesn't fit with a specific animal from this list or the player feels their animal embodies a different effect from the list, feel free to reflavor the feat names to fit the hero's spirit face. For instance, the Cunning Trickster mask could easily be a rodent or a fox, not just a spider.
